Active between 1970 and 1976, the
Bolton Iron Maiden
(originally known as
Birth
and then
Iron Maiden
) was a psychedelic hard-rock band formed in Bolton by
Ian Boulton-Smith
(
Beak
) on lead guitar,
Derek George Austin
on bass and
Paul TJ O'Neill
on drums/vocals. Influenced by contemporaries like
Led Zeppelin
,
Cream
,
Free
,
Groundhogs
, or
Andromeda
, their music blended blues, hard rock, and progressive elements. They soon built a strong reputation supporting acts such as
UFO
,
Bedlam
(with
Cozy Powell
),
Caravan
,
Thin Lizzy
, and more. In 1976, the band disbanded following the death of guitarist Ian Boulton-Smith from cancer. In 2005, Paul O'Neill revived interest in BIM by releasing two albums,
Maiden Flight
and
Boulton Rides Again
, which compiled studio and live recordings. The proceeds from these albums were donated to Cancer Research and Macmillan Cancer Support. With the blessing of the more famous
Iron Maiden
and their manager
Rod Smallwood
, the band adopted the name "The Bolton Iron Maiden" to avoid confusion. For the first time on vinyl,
Maiden Flight
collects their previously unreleased studio recordings from 1972 plus raw as f*ck live tracks circa 1975. Includes insert with detailed liner notes and rare photos/memorabilia along with download card with extra (live) bonus track.
